It is important to note that you would have to be physically located within state lines to actually place bets. This is because sportsbooks are using a software called geolocation tracking to ensure they are compliant by accepting bets only from users in the state. You can, however, manage your wagering account when out of state with the app; for instance, New Jersey bettors can check their accounts or make withdrawals while in New York, but they would have to come back to New Jersey when they want to place wagers.
Finding the best odds and lines
Before placing your wagers, you must ensure you are getting the best possible odds. Initially, the difference between -105 and -110 might not seem like much, but if you bet frequently, it will add up to a significant amount in the long run. Considering that odds and lines are moving very often, the best approach to ensuring you are always betting at the best possible price is to have several accounts with all the top bookies and check, bet by bet, who has the best price.
So before placing any bets, remember to compare the odds at multiple books to find the best possible deal. For instance, an MLB money line for a favorite might reveal prices of -120, -125, and -115. As you can see, the last sports betting site has the best deal, but if you hadn’t checked, you could have gone for one of the other two, missing out on some extra value. Once you have multiple accounts with sports betting sites, it is straightforward to compare the odds, and it won’t take more than 5 minutes.

The different types of online sportsbook bonuses and promotions
Since the competition is increasing in many states, legal bookmakers try to make themselves visible by offering lots of bonuses and promotions. Some offers are just a one-time thing, while others reward loyalty. It might become confusing with so many opportunities out there, so below, we have summarized the most common ones to help you get oriented.
- No deposit: This is usually a small free bet of $10 that is offered to users who sign up for a betting site. These free funds can be used before making the first deposit.
- Risk-free bet: with this promotion, you will get a refund if your free bet ends up losing. The refund can be as much as $500, although you would have to play it through on the site before being allowed to withdraw.
- Deposit match: the sports betting site will match your initial deposit up to a certain amount. Similarly to above, the matched funds won’t be immediately eligible for withdrawal.
- Odds boost: books will boost the odds for some bets from time to time. This is a great chance to get extra returns on wagers that you might already have wanted to place.
- Parlay insurance: if one leg of your multi-team parlay loses, you will get your money back. It’s a great way to lower the risk of a parlay bet, but you have to choose at least a certain number of options to be eligible for the offer.
Even if the promotions we have listed above are very popular, each operator will have different terms and conditions. Therefore, to stay on top of the current offers and avoid disappointments, make sure you understand all the terms well before getting involved.
Online sports betting launch dates by state
The time when sports betting was only legal in Nevada is long gone. With the change in the law in 2018, now every state in the US is free to determine if they want to make sports betting legal. Below is an updated view of all the different states in the US where you can wager on sports at the moment of writing.
Arizona Sports Betting – Legal, launched September 2021
Colorado Sports Betting – Legal, launched May 2020
Connecticut Sports Betting – Legal, launched October 2021
Illinois Sports Betting – Legal, launched August 2020
Indiana Sports Betting – Legal, launched October 2019
Iowa Sports Betting – Legal, launched August 2019
Louisiana Sports Betting – Legal, launched January 2022
Maryland Sports Betting – Legal, launched November 2022
Michigan Sports Betting – Legal, launched January 2021
Mississippi Sports Betting – Legal, launched September 2021
Montana Sports Betting – Legal, launched March 2020
Nevada Sports Betting – Legal, online launched in 2010
New Hampshire Sports Betting – Legal, launched in December 2019
New Jersey Sports Betting – Legal, launched in August 2018
New York Sports Betting – Legal, launched in January 2022
Kansas Sports Betting – Legal, launched in September 2022
Oregon Sports Betting – Legal, launched in October 2019
Ohio Sports Betting – Legal, launched in January 2022
Pennsylvania Sports Betting – Legal, launched in May 2019
Rhode Island Sports Betting – Legal, launched September 2019
Tennessee Sports Betting – Legal, launched November 2020
Virginia Sports Betting – Legal, January 2021
Washington, DC Sports Betting – Legal, launched August 2020
West Virginia Sports Betting – Legal, launched August 2019
Wyoming Sports Betting – Legal, launched September 2021
Clearly, this picture is not the final one. There are lots of states that are at different stages in the process of legalizing sports betting. As the situation progresses, we will update the table accordingly, and you can also check our dedicated section, where we provide the latest in-depth guide on what the situation is in each of the listed states and how things are going there.
As you can imagine, rules and regulations aren’t the same for every state: for instance, some states allow retail sports betting but not online, while others offer both but still require in-person registration. Furthermore, each state has different views on the types of bets that are permitted, particularly in college sports. All the legal states, however, have some common rules, and these are:
- All bets must be made within the state on a licensed app or website for sports betting.
- You can’t bet on high school sports or events where most of the people involved are underage.
Legal Sports Betting by State Guide
At the time of this writing, sports betting is legal in roughly half of the United States. Several states are in the process of legalizing their sportsbooks, so the situation is in rapid evolution. Even states that have traditionally been against gambling expansion, like Tennessee and Virginia, now have online sportsbooks these days. As you can see, the sports betting situation in the US is very fluid, yet below we have provided an overview of the current scenario state by state at the moment of writing. This will be updated from time to time.
States with legal online and retail sports betting
If you want to have full-service sports betting, several states offer that. Lots of these states were the first to launch sports betting after the fall of PASPA.
Arizona
The Grand Canyon State made it from passing the law (April 2021) to launching (September 2021) in only five months. The official launch was Sept. 9, with the online sports betting market having seven apps on opening day. Additionally, two sportsbooks opened at the Phoenix stadium.
Colorado
Colorado has rapidly become one of the hottest markets after legalizing sports betting. A 2019 referendum legalized retail and online wagering, with casino sportsbooks and online apps launching in 2020. Currently, around two dozen sportsbooks apps live in Colorado, including some top names in the industry.
The number of apps rivals that of New Jersey, showing that this state is a central one for the US sports betting industry. In Colorado, you will also find several commercial and tribal casinos, with the majority positioned in the gambling cities of Black Hawk, Central City, and Cripple Creek.
Connecticut
For a variety of reasons, the launch of sports betting in Connecticut took longer than expected. But in May 2021, a law signed by Gov. Ned Lamont got things on the way, and there have been three sports betting apps launched in October 2021, with the opening of temporary sportsbooks at Mohegan and Foxwoods casinos.
Illinois
The Land of Lincoln has legalized sports betting in 2020. Strangely, the law that made sports betting legal in Illinois said that a person had to go to the state to sign up for and put money into an online sportsbook account. This requirement expired on March 5, 2022.
Indiana
Indiana took part in the second wave of sportsbook launches of 2019. Online betting was launched in October 2019 in the Hoosier State, with bettors able to register through their computer or mobile device and place wagers on almost everything, including in-state college teams. The Indiana Gaming Commission has veto power over live betting and data sources in sports betting, with around a dozen online and retail sportsbooks currently active in the state.
Iowa
Iowa launched its sports betting market in August 2019. The Hawkeye State was able to debut sportsbooks just three months after Gov. Kim Reynolds signed SF 617. Initially, Iowa maintained that players had to register and make their first deposit into online sportsbooks in the state in person. That provision, however, ended in 2021, so now it is perfectly possible to register a new account, transfer funds, and place your bets from anywhere inside Iowa, as well as remotely. Unfortunately, it is not possible to bet on in-state college teams.
Louisiana
Louisiana launched sports betting in October 2021. Around a dozen retail sportsbooks have opened in the Pelican State since then. The sports betting market in the state expanded in January 2022, with online sports betting launched in 55 of the state’s 64 parishes. Louisianans can now bet on the Saints, Pelicans, and even Tigers of LSU.
Michigan
Michigan has made a name for itself with online gambling and sports betting. The Great Lakes State had ten different apps that came online simultaneously, most of them representing some of the world’s most trusted and largest sportsbook brands. In addition, Michigan is one of four states that currently offer (or plan to offer) online casino, poker, and sports betting. The Michigan Gaming Control Board offers in-state college teams and has even allowed Oscars betting. There are no prop bets on college sports at the Michigan sportsbook.
Nevada
Nevada was the first state in the United States to legalize online sports betting. Thanks to PASPA, the Silver State had a monopoly on online sports betting for decades. Now that many states are coming online, Nevada is still leading the way, thanks to the collective expertise that the state has acquired over the years.
Even so, Silver State requires players to visit the land-based partner casino of the sportsbook app they want to use in order to complete the registration. Additionally, all deposits and withdrawals have to be completed in person. The rule, which is likely to stay, is a protection for the state’s biggest taxpayers, which are the casinos, of course.
New Hampshire
New Hampshire is an example of a state-run operator offering sports betting is New Hampshire.Unlike other states, New Hampshire conducted an open bidding process for a single license. The winner was DraftKings, which had to agree to share 50% of its revenue with the state as a tax. Surely, that level is higher than in other states, but the operator will have a monopoly and control over the state’s land-based sportsbooks.
New Jersey
New Jersey is, without doubt, the new center of sports betting in the US. Sports bettors wager around $1 billion per month on sportsbooks in New Jersey, with the vast majority (more than 90%) of these bets occurring online. Also, the state is on the cutting edge of new features like the cashout option and is looking into the possibility of live betting and betting on the Oscars.
New York
New York is the most populous state to offer sports betting. The Empire State has been a full-service sports betting location since January 2022, with online and retail sportsbooks available within its borders. Sports betting is not entirely new for New York, as, since July 2019, four commercial casinos and some of its tribal casinos have been allowed to host retail sports betting. A half-dozen sportsbook apps are operating in the state, with nearly a dozen sportsbooks taking wagers here.
Ohio
Although it wasn’t simple, Ohio’s lawmakers eventually passed a sports betting bill in December 2021, and Gov. Mike DeWine signed it. Ohio’s online sportsbooks launched on January 1, 2023, and the state will have up to 25 online sportsbooks when it reaches maturity.
Oregon
Oregon is not a full-service state for sports betting because its sportsbook app has some limitations right now. Similarly to New Hampshire, Oregon lawmakers decided to keep online sports betting more ‘in-house’ than in other states, with the Oregon Lottery controlling the whole industry. Scoreboard is the only app in the state at the moment.
Kansas
Kansas has legalized sports betting, and on September 1st, a limited launch took place with six sports betting sites available. Each casino license allows three online sportsbooks in addition to retail sportsbooks. The four casinos in the state are allowed to run brick-and-mortar sportsbooks and collaborate with a maximum of three internet casinos.
Pennsylvania
Pennsylvania was the first “main” state to offer online sports betting within its borders. When the Supreme Court struck down PASPA, Pennsylvania had a law in place similar to New Jersey’s that permitted sports betting.So the launch of sports betting was just a matter of time.
The Pennsylvania Gaming Control Board required a $10 million license fee and a 36% tax rate for any online sportsbook, which has slowed down the delivery of licenses. Despite that, Pennsylvania is now home to a dozen online sportsbooks, which can accept wagers on most sports, including college sports.
West Virginia
West Virginia launched its online sports betting surprisingly quickly. The Mountain State was ready immediately after the fall of PASPA, with several sports betting operators starting in the following months. Now online sports betting (and retail) is in full swing in the state.
Rhode Island
Rhode Island was the first state to decide to operate a more state-run approach to sports betting. Sports betting started in November 2018 with a retail operation at the state’s two casinos in Lincoln and Tiverton. These two casinos are owned by Bally’s Corporation, with the sports betting operations run by IFT. Since September 2019, both online and retail sports betting have been available in the state, with the only online sportsbook brand being Sportsbook Rhode Island.
Washington, DC.
The nation’s capital is also a sports betting destination. Even though Washington, DC, is relatively small in terms of area, there are more than 700,000 residents and many visitors, making it a very attractive location for sports betting. The DC Lottery is in charge of sports betting in the district and is the only entity that can offer online sports betting with their GambeDC app.
DC also permits other companies to provide retail and online sportsbooks, but only in certain designated areas. As a result, the district is one of the few places in the US where retail sports betting has been more popular than online.
Mississippi
Mississippi was one of the first states to legalize sports betting. The law, however, makes online sports betting legal only while the player is present on the premises of the casino. So, although Mississippi is formally a legal online sports betting state, current restrictions prevent the development of a proper online sports betting market.
Maryland
In November 2020, the people of Maryland passed a referendum that made it legal to bet in the state. The state Legislature then officially legalized retail and online betting in 2021, with legal online sports betting starting on November 23, 2022.
Montana
Montana is like Mississippi in that you can only bet on sports online when you are at a registered sportsbook. Montana has also kept things “in-house” with the only authorized sportsbook provider, Intralot, who has both control over retail and the limited online applications.
States with active online sports betting
Tennessee
Tennessee’s decision to let people bet on sports was surprising, to say the least, because the state has always been against gambling. However, in November 2020, the Volunteer State decided to allow four sportsbooks to start offering service online. So, Tennessee is the first state in the country to offer sports betting only online and not in stores.
Virginia
Similarly to Tennessee, Virginia doesn’t have any casino locations, yet decided in January 2021 to open its own sports betting market. Despite the fact that for the time being, Virginia is just online, there are plans to allow the construction of five land-based casinos in the state in the near future.
Wyoming
Wyoming launched its online-only market in September 2021. Similarly to Tennessee, the offer is only online, despite the fact that there are some tribal casinos that could offer sportsbooks if they decide to do so.
States with retail sports betting active
Arkansas
Arkansas had a reputation for being gambling-hostile, so it was a surprise that sports betting was legalized in 2019. Mobile or online wagering is not yet allowed, despite several attempts to date.
Delaware
Delaware was the first state to offer single-event wagering after the fall of PASPA. Currently, there are three racinos in the state, and all of these are now sportsbook locations. Delaware has also legalized online betting, yet this is not live yet.
North Carolina
North Carolina doesn’t have comprehensive legislation to enable sports betting in the state. There are no regular casinos in the Tar Heel State, but tribal casinos are in operation by the Eastern Band of Cherokee Indians, where sports betting has been allowed since July 2019. The first retail sportsbook was opened in March 2021, and both casinos, Harrah’s Cherokee and Harrah’s Cherokee Valley River, now have sports betting operations. Online sports betting is not allowed in the state, so the current situation is pretty limited in North Carolina.
New Mexico
There is no active New Mexico sports betting legislature. However, Santa Ana Star Casino opened for sports betting in October 2018, even if this has been disputed. Since then, other tribes in New Mexico have opened four other sportsbooks in light of the evolving situation in the state.
South Dakota
South Dakota’s first retail sportsbook opened in September 2021, but right now sports betting is only allowed at the Deadwood casinos. This is because of a law that was passed in the spring of 2021. Mobile apps might become available, but they are currently limited to on-property betting only.
Washington
In September 2021, Washington’s first retail sportsbook was launched at Snoqualmie Casino. Since 2020, tribal casinos are allowed to offer sports betting and online sports betting only on site.

I’m new to sports betting and don’t understand how the odds work.
Understanding the odds is not difficult, and you will get used to it soon. Every event has a favorite (which has negative odds) and an underdog (positive odds). The odds are based on winning $100 (negative: the amount of money you need to stake to do so) or the amount you win if you bet $100 (when wagering on positive odds).
